Study on Industrialization Process of Thiotriazinone
In order to improve the product quality and yield by finding out the optimal technological conditions,thiotriazinone sodium was synthesized by condensation of 2-methyl-3-thiosemicarbazide,diethyl oxalate and sodium methylate in a mixed solvent(a polar proton solvent and a polar non-proton solvent)at 0~45℃,then the target product thiotriazinone(TTZ)was obtained by hydrochloric acid acidification.By using mixed solvents,the viscosity of the synthesized process system was greatly improved,the yield of thiotriazinone(TTZ)was increased to more than 90%(calculated by 2-methyl-3-thiosemicarbazide),and the average purity was over 99.5%,the by-product material,1-methyl-5-mercapto-1,2,4-triazole-3-carboxylate(TTA),was less than 0.1%.So,this industrial method is suitable for the synthesis of thiotriazinone(TTZ).
